Name
Bulimus pyrostomus Pfeiffer, 1860 – Wikispecies link – Pensoft Profile
- Bulimus pyrostomus Pfeiffer 1860[1]: 137; Breure and Schouten 1985[2]: 59, 72.
- Placostylus (Santacharis) salomonis (Pfeiffer); Solem 1959[3]: 132, pl. 8 fig. 5 (lectotype designation).
- Santacharis salomonis (Pfeiffer); Delsaerdt 2010[4]: 76, pl. 12 figs 13–14.
Type locality
[Vanuatu, Erromanga] “Erumanga, New Hebrides”.
Label
“Isle of Eurymanga, New Hebrides”, taxon label in Pfeiffer’s handwriting. M.C. label style III.
Dimensions
“Long. 42, diam. 19 mill.”; lectotype H 41.5, D 22.0, W 5.3.
Type material
NHMUK 1975235, lectotype and two paralectotypes (Cuming coll.).
Remarks
According to Solem (1959)[3] the “holotype of pyrostomus is more slender than most of the specimens seen, but it is not too atypical. The holotype of salomonis could not be located in the British Museum”. Solem based his comments on a photograph of the type and was possibly unaware of the existence of two additional specimens. His “holotype of pyrostomus” is here interpreted as a lectotype designation (Art. 74.6 ICZN), overruling the subsequent designation by Breure and Schouten (1985: 59). See also under Bulimus salomonis.
Current systematic position
Bothriembryontidae, Santacharis salomonis (Pfeiffer, 1853).
